CHAMPAIGN, Ill.-- The Miami University baseball team dropped a pair of games to the University of Illinois by the scores of 2-0 and 5-1 Saturday afternoon. The RedHawks dropped to 19-28 while the Illini improve to 25-19.
Game one was a pitching duel between the RedHawks and Illini. Miami pitchers
Jonathan Brand and
Michael Spinozzi combined to allow just one earned run.
Game two saw the RedHawks fall 5-1.
Zach MacDonald provided the offense for the Red and White with his solo home run.

HOW IT HAPPENED: Game Two
- In the top of the second, trailing 1-0, Zach MacDonald hit a solo home run to center field.
- The Illini took a one-run lead in the bottom of the fifth before extending their lead to four in the eighth.
Miami Game Notes: Game Two
- MacDonald hit his team-leading ninth home run.
- Parker Lester reached base twice on a pair of walks.
- Zach Maxey and Ryan Starr threw a combined six innings while allowing just two earned runs.
